
Ted Ford
Assistant Professor of Art History
Ted Ford is an art historian and educator who has taught at Pratt Munson since 2004. His work integrates studio practice with modern and post-modern cultural theory and contemporary art criticism, and he teaches a range of courses including First Year Survey, 19th c. Art, 20th-Century Modernism, and the Fine Art Seminar.
